Westmoreland County will pay more than $68,000 to rent space for an expanded human services department that will be located about six miles from the courthouse in Greensburg. Commissioners on Thursday approved an 11-month lease for seven suites in the Business Information Center at Westmoreland County Community College near Youngwood.
